dc.description.abstract | Independent component analysis (ICA) aims at decomposing an observed random vector into statistically independent variables. A novel method for deflationary ICA, referred to as RobustICA. This simple technique consists of performing exact line search optimization of the kurtosis contrast function. RobustICA can avoid prewhitening and deals with real- and complex-valued mixtures of possibly audio sources alike. The absence of prewhitening improves asymptotic performance. | en_US |
